在微信生态系统中,小程序以其轻量级、易开发、跨平台等优势,成为了开发者和用户喜爱的应用形式。Nina框架作为微信小程序开发的一个强大工具,可以帮助开发者快速构建出个性化且互动性强的应用程序。下面,我将详细介绍一下Nina框架的特点、使用方法以及如何利用它打造独特的互动体验。
一、Nina框架简介
Nina框架是由微信官方推出的一款专为微信小程序设计的UI框架。它提供了丰富的组件和样式,可以帮助开发者简化开发流程,提高开发效率。Nina框架的特点如下:
- 组件丰富:涵盖了按钮、表单、列表、卡片等多种常用组件,满足不同场景下的设计需求。
- 样式多样:提供了多种主题和样式,开发者可以根据需求自定义样式,打造个性化的视觉效果。
- 响应式设计:支持多种屏幕尺寸,确保小程序在不同设备上都能保持良好的展示效果。
- 易于上手:学习曲线平缓,即使是初学者也能快速掌握。
二、Nina框架的使用方法
1. 安装Nina框架
首先,需要在微信开发者工具中安装Nina框架。具体步骤如下:
- 打开微信开发者工具,点击“工具”菜单。
- 选择“UI框架”。
- 在弹出的窗口中,选择“Nina”框架,点击“安装”按钮。
2. 创建Nina组件
在安装好Nina框架后,可以在项目中创建Nina组件。以下是一个简单的示例:
<!-- index.wxml -->
<view class="container">
<nina-button type="primary">点击我</nina-button>
</view>
/* index.wxss */
.container {
display: flex;
justify-content: center;
align-items: center;
height: 100%;
}
在这个例子中,我们创建了一个按钮组件,并设置了按钮的样式。
3. 使用Nina组件
在Nina框架中,可以使用各种组件来构建页面。以下是一些常用的组件及其使用方法:
- 按钮(Button):用于触发事件,如点击、长按等。
- 表单(Form):用于收集用户输入,如文本、选择、开关等。
- 列表(List):用于展示数据列表,如商品列表、新闻列表等。
- 卡片(Card):用于展示信息卡片,如文章卡片、商品卡片等。
三、打造个性化互动体验
利用Nina框架,开发者可以轻松打造出具有个性化互动体验的小程序。以下是一些方法:
- 自定义样式:通过修改Nina框架的样式,可以打造出独特的视觉效果。
- 添加动画效果:使用微信小程序提供的动画API,为组件添加动画效果,提升用户体验。
- 交互式元素:通过添加交互式元素,如轮播图、地图等,增强用户的参与感。
- 数据可视化:利用图表、地图等数据可视化组件,将数据以直观的方式呈现给用户。
四、总结
Nina框架为微信小程序开发者提供了一个高效、便捷的开发工具。通过掌握Nina框架的使用方法,开发者可以快速构建出具有个性化互动体验的小程序。无论是初学者还是经验丰富的开发者,Nina框架都能帮助你们在微信小程序开发的道路上更进一步。
